Default Reseller Questions...

I am looking to expand my base and have an addtional back up reseller account. Based on your answers I will decide on how to best utilize your services.

Questions concerning your hosting packages.

With the reseller packages
How many accounts are alloted to the reseller packages?

Is it possible to to create a package so that each "resold" account set up /added has thier own unique IP? (I know there would be a marginal fee of a dollar a month)

Email server. Is your server in the header of the email source instead of the resellers domain/ ip?

Why has Hostnine.com's Ip changed 10 in the past 1 year? ( there can be several reasons and it raises concern on your longevity of business)

What are your overage charges/ policy for resellers? Bandwidth? Disk Space?

Are accounts dispersed across network or are all accounts a reseller creates kept on same MAchine?

How many accounts are maintained on a machine?

Do you have physical access to the servers?

What are three of your highest traffic domain accounts, not on a dedicated machine?

What is the default http web upload size for your servers?

Do you have Imagemagick properly installed and tested with perl on an account with cPanel? (I have run on to the common error of having Imagemagick being misconfigured and reffering to the older package after past cpanel updates)

Is SSH jailed?

I read in your Terms and Conditions indecent speech. What is considered "indecent speech" Some sites I run for people are message borads and they use mature lang to express them self as quite often saying "oh Poo poo" just doesn't covey the emotion required express them self . no defamitory or hate type talk simply people talking. but indecent leaves allot of room for interpretation (to much so I might add especially for an american based business)
